"Will reduce export revenues by 70-80 billion dollars": McFaul-Yermak group proposed sanctions against Western companies in Russia and "shadow fleet", embargo on uranium, aluminum and steel, and confiscation of Russian assets
The McFaul-Yermack Sanctions Group presented the Action Plan 3. 0, proposing measures such as confiscation of frozen assets of the Russian central bank, increased enforcement of oil price ceilings, a full embargo on Russian uranium, aluminum and steel exports, sanctions against Western companies operating in Russia, and equating tax payments to Russia with bribery to undermine Russia's economic and military capabilities to halt its aggression in Ukraine.

The State Energy Supervision Service predicts a decrease in the number of power outage schedules: what is known
The recent blackouts were caused by a sharp cold snap and damage to many maneuverable generating facilities as a result of missile and drone attacks by Russia, but some warming is expected in the next few days, which could reduce the shortage of generating capacity and the number of curtailment schedules.
Even despite increased taxation banks earned UAH 40.5 billion in 2024: who earned the most
In the first quarter of 2024, Ukrainian banks earned a net profit of UAH 40. 5 billion after tax, up 19% year-on-year, despite the increase in the tax rate from 18% to 25%.

Austria establishes EUR 500 million special fund to support investments in Ukraine
Austria has opened a EUR 500 million special loan fund to support export operations with Ukraine over the next five years, providing risk coverage and facilitating investments crucial for Ukraine's recovery, particularly in infrastructure, transport and supply.

Where people choose Tesla and other electric cars: bestsellers by region
In April, more than 4,200 electric vehicles were registered in Ukraine, with Lviv region leading the way with 595 units, followed by Kyiv, Dnipropetrovska oblast, Kyiv region, and Vinnytsia region. The most popular new electric car was the Volkswagen ID.4, while the most popular used imported models were the Nissan Leaf, Tesla Model Y, and Tesla Model 3.
